16.4 FNC 83 – HEX / ASCII to Hexadecimal Conversion
16.4 FNC 83 – HEX / ASCII to Hexadecimal Conversion
Outline
This instruction converts ASCII codes into hexadecimal codes.
On the other hand, DABIN (FNC260) instruction converts ASCII codes into binary data, and EVAL (FNC117)
instruction converts ASCII codes into binary floating point data.
For DABIN (FNC260) instruction, refer to Section 29.5.
For EVAL (FNC117) instruction, refer to Section 18.5.

Explanation of function and operation
1. 16-bit operation (HEX and HEXP)
Among the ASCII codes stored in and later, "n" characters are converted into hexadecimal codes, and then
stored to the devices and later.
The 16-bit mode and 8-bit mode are available for this instruction. For operation in each mode, refer to the proceeding
pages.
